Eating peanut butter can be an affordable way for a person to add more protein for a better nutritional balance. The peanut butter can be bought in chunky or creamy varieties and made into many different foods including sandwiches, shakes, crackers and anything one can dream up. Peanut butter has many benefits to offer nutritionally.
No matter how much time you spend reading nutrition labels and eating healthy, one of the biggest factors to any successful nutrition plan is still to exercise regularly. A strong nutrition plan can't make up for a lack of exercise and no matter how healthy your diet plan may be, you won't see the full effect of it until you begin exercising regularly.
Meditate to keep your body running in the most healthy and efficient manner. Meditating helps control your stress. Chronic stress increases the risk of hypertension, stroke, heart disease, diabetes, ulcers, insomnia, muscle aches and depression. Clearly, stress is a medical condition that you must talk to your doctor about.

To add some flavor to your meals, fresh herbs are a wonderful option. You can grow them yourself in your kitchen, or you can buy them fresh from your local farmers market or grocery store. Adding herbs to your meals will add a ton of flavor to your cooking.
A good nutrition tip that everyone should implement into their life is to educate themselves on portion size and the amount of calories they should intake daily. This is not going to be the same for everyone so it is important that you find out what your body needs specifically.
In order to have a high metabolism and be able to burn the food you've eaten, you must exercise. No pill can do this correctly for you, and neither can food. You must get this part of your diet from consistent exercise. Make it a routine part of your life.
